Schiaparelli | Sustainability Performance
Franco-Italian haute couture fashion house founded by Elsa Schiaparelli, one of the most renowned designers of the first half of the 20th century, known for her collaborations with artists such as Salvador Dalí. Revived in the 21st century under the ownership of Tod’s Group, the brand is celebrated for its theatrical couture and distinctive sculptural jewelry.
